There is no such xyz-wing, because r8c3 is 238, not 239.
Without using chains, you probably need 5 steps like this:
- Code: Select all
*---------------------------------------------------------------*
| 9 246 5 | 268 1 248 | 7 48 3 |
| 3 7 28 | 5 #248 9 | 1 6 #248 |
| 68 246 1 | 268 3 7 | 59 489 258-4 |
|--------------------+---------------------+--------------------|
| 7 3 6 | 1 28 28 | 4 5 9 |
| 2 5 4 | 9 7 3 | 8 1 6 |
| 1 8 9 | 4 6 5 | 2 3 7 |
|--------------------+---------------------+--------------------|
| *58 29 7 | 3 *258-4 24-8 | 6 489 1 |
| 568 269 238 | *28 #2458 1 | 39 7 #48 |
| 4 1 38 | 7 9 6 | 35 2 58 |
*---------------------------------------------------------------*
x-wing 4r28c49 (#) -> -4r7c5,r3c9
xyz-wing 258 r7c15,r8c4 (*) -> -8r7c6
- Code: Select all
*---------------------------------------------------------------*
| 9 246 5 | 268 1 248 | 7 48 3 |
| 3 7 28 | 5 248 9 | 1 6 248 |
| 68 246 1 | 268 3 7 | 59 489 258 |
|--------------------+---------------------+--------------------|
| 7 3 6 | 1 28 28 | 4 5 9 |
| 2 5 4 | 9 7 3 | 8 1 6 |
| 1 8 9 | 4 6 5 | 2 3 7 |
|--------------------+---------------------+--------------------|
| 58 29 7 | 3 258 *24 | 6 89-4 1 |
| 568 269 238 | *28 258-4 1 | 39 7 *48 |
| 4 1 38 | 7 9 6 | 35 2 58 |
*---------------------------------------------------------------*
xy-wing 28,4 r8c49,r7c6 (*) -> -4r7c8,r8c5
- Code: Select all
+--------------------+----------------+----------------+
| 9 246 5 | 268 1 28 | 7 48 3 |
| 3 7 #28 | 5 4 9 | 1 6 #28 |
| 68 246 1 | 268 3 7 | 59 489 25-8 |
+--------------------+----------------+----------------+
| 7 3 6 | 1 28 28 | 4 5 9 |
| 2 5 4 | 9 7 3 | 8 1 6 |
| 1 8 9 | 4 6 5 | 2 3 7 |
+--------------------+----------------+----------------+
| 58 *29 7 | 3 258 4 | 6 8-9 1 |
| 568 26-9 *23-8 | 28 258 1 |*39 7 4 |
| 4 1 #38 | 7 9 6 | 35 2 #58 |
+--------------------+----------------+----------------+
x-wing 8r29c39 (#) -> -8r3c9,r7c3
xy-wing 23,9 r8c37,r7c2 -> -9r7c8,r9c2